Cristopher Nkunku has opened up and told Mauricio Pochettino that he would like to be the main striker for CHELSEA .

After making the move to Stamford Bridge right at the beginning of the summer transfer window – Nkunku has been settling into life as a Blue and getting used to the way Pochettino likes to play the game.

Nkunku enjoyed his first outing in a Blues shirt and relished playing as the central striker during his 45 minutes on the pitch against Wrexham in Chapel Hill.

Nkunku looked lively throughout his maiden outing for the club , with his sharp movement on and off the ball getting many of the fans excited ahead of the upcoming season.

He combined well with his new team-mates, and he explained after the game that he is hoping to be the main striker for us- as that is the position he is most happy with.

WHAT HAS BEEN SAID – 

‘We scored five goals and didn’t concede so it’s good for our confidence,’ said Nkunku on the club website

‘For me I like to play this position, to be free to move and to have the ball into my feet and into space also. This is my position. I was very happy.

‘I’m a new player, I try to have a good relationship with everybody, and to know everybody also. This will be important for the following games.’

‘We have found it good. We just need adaptation and we are working in training for this. The next week will be very positive.

‘It is very hot – also good weather! – but very hot. But we know we came here for work and to improve in our pre-season.’
